iptables介绍 linux的包过滤功能,即linux防火墙,它由netfilter 和 iptables 两个组件组成。 netfilter 组件也称为内核空间,是内核的一部分,由一些信息包过滤表组成,这些表包含内核用来控制信息包过滤处理的规则集。 iptables 组件是一种工具,也称为用户空间,它使插入、修改和除去信息包过滤表中的规则变得容易。iptables基础 我们知道iptable
# 实现在Linux中查找日志内容包含关键字的方法 ## 1.整体流程 整个过程主要包含以下几个步骤: | 步骤 | 操作 | | --- | --- | | 1 | 连接到Linux服务器 | | 2 | 使用grep命令查找日志内容 | | 3 | 确认查找结果 | ## 2.具体操作步骤 ### 步骤一:连接到Linux服务器 首先需要通过SSH连接到Linux服务器,输入服
原创 2024-04-26 09:17:13
194阅读
学会查看日志的重要性:便于定位问题,及时解决问题,及时处理故障。日志的类型:          1.内核及系统日志:由系统rsyslog统一管理,根据其主配置文件/etc/rsyslog.conf中的设置决定将内核消息及各种系统程序消息记录到系统的文件位置中。特点:由rsyslog管理,日志记录具有相似的格式。    &nbsp
# 如何使用Docker查看日志包含 作为一名经验丰富的开发者,我将教会你如何使用Docker查看包含特定内容的日志。这是一个非常有用的技能,能够帮助你更快地定位和解决问题。下面是整个流程的步骤: | 步骤 | 操作 | | -------- | -------- | | 1 | 进入Docker容器 | | 2 | 使用`grep`命令查看包含特定内容的日志 | | 3 | 退出Docker
原创 2024-07-10 04:12:55
47阅读
Linux操作系统作为一种开源操作系统,自带了许多强大的功能和工具,其中的if命令就是其中之一。if命令在Linux系统中被广泛应用,用于流程控制和条件判断。通过if命令,用户可以根据不同的条件执行不同的操作,这对于编写脚本和自动化任务非常有用。 在Linux系统中,if命令的语法类似于其他编程语言中的if语句,它用于判断给定的条件是否成立,然后根据结果执行相应的操作。if命令通常与条件表达式和
原创 2024-03-04 10:13:21
81阅读
Rsyslog:本篇文章更多参考(如有需要,可直接参阅原文):http://zm10.sm-img2.com/?src=http%3A%2F%2Fw.gdu.me%2Fwiki%2FLinux%2Frsyslog_logrotate.html&uid=841f32121bbc0a168eee69bf5ffa880b&hid=6af25f4f8c2beab005677505e0e44
# MySQL错误日志的实现 ## 概述 MySQL错误日志是记录MySQL服务器运行过程中发生的错误的重要组成部分。它可以帮助开发者追踪和调试问题,以及提供有价值的信息用于故障排除。本文将为你介绍如何实现MySQL错误日志,并提供详细的步骤和代码示例。 ## 实现步骤 下面是实现MySQL错误日志的步骤,我们会在每一步中给出相应的代码示例和解释。 步骤 | 操作 | 代码示例 ----|
原创 2023-08-25 10:20:48
45阅读
MySQL是如何做到恢复到半月内任意一秒的状态。我们从一个表的更新说起,新建一张表:mysql> create table T(ID int primary key, c int);如果将id=2这一行的值加1,SQL语句就会这样写:mysql> update T set c=c+1 where ID=2;sql语句查询执行的过程更新也同样会再走一遍,与查询语句不一样的是,更新流程设计
1.MySQL 服务器都提供了哪几种类型的日志文件?说明每种日志的用途。 提供了五种日志文件分别为: 错误日志,与启动,关闭和异常情况有关的诊断信息,通常默认启动状态。 常规查询日志,指服务器从客户端收到的所有语句,需要进行配置。 慢速查询日志,需要很长时间执行的查询,需要进行配置。 审计日志,企业版基于策略的审计,审计日志很重要,需要进行配置。 二进制日志,修改数据的语句,通常默认启动状态。 2
转载 2023-11-11 09:18:49
113阅读
今天看文章学了一招,有包含漏洞无法传文件的时候用 目标服务器环境为ubuntu,ssh登录日志文件是/var/log/auth.log 找个Linux的环境执行ssh '<? phpinfo(); ?>'@192.168.48.129 这个时候我们看下auth.log里面有什么 PHP代码被成功写入 ...
转载 2021-09-02 11:30:00
1320阅读
2评论
首先要记住的是: 正则表达式与通配符不一样,它们表示的含义并不相同! 正则表达式只是一种表示法,只要工具支持这种表示法, 那么该工具就可以处理正则表达式的字符串。vim、grep、awk 、sed 都支持正则表达式,也正是因为由于它们支持正则,才显得它们强大;在以前上班的公司里,由于公司是基于web的服务型网站(nginx),对正则的需求比 较大,所以也花了点时间研究正则,特与大家分享下:1基
Linux不停止服务快速清空日志文件(包含所有文件,不光是日志
原创 精选 2023-05-13 00:59:42
1276阅读
Linux系统中,文件包含(File Inclusion)是一种常见的安全漏洞。文件包含是指在Web应用程序中动态地包含文件或代码时,存在一定的安全风险,黑客可以利用这个漏洞来获取敏感信息或者执行恶意代码,造成严重的安全问题。 在Linux系统中,文件包含漏洞一般分为两种:本地文件包含(Local File Inclusion,LFI)和远程文件包含(Remote File Inclusion
原创 2024-03-07 13:18:16
108阅读
对Android开发者来讲,尤其是使用NDK编写Native层代码的开发者,在编码过程中通常会碰到各种各样的问题。追踪问题的方式有很多,除了在代码中添加日志,来观察程序运行过程中产生的异常外,对崩溃后产生的日志进行分析也是一种重要的定位问题的方式。 Android系统自带一个非常实用的Native层代码崩溃监测进程debuggerd。该进程可以监听到应用程序的崩溃,并将崩溃后的信息输
目录日志类型日志优先级常用日志文件日志文件详细介绍last命令cat, tail 和 watchtail -fLinux系统拥有非常灵活和强大的日志功能,可以保存几乎所有的操作记录,并可以从中检索出我们需要的信息。 大部分Linux发行版默认的日志守护进程为 syslog,位于 /etc/syslog 或 /etc/syslogd 或 /etc/rsyslog.d,默认配置文件为 /etc/sys
转载 2024-06-17 06:13:18
112阅读
关于系统日志的主要配置文件有两个: /etc/sysconfig/syslog这里定义syslog服务启动时可加入的参数。 /etc/syslog.conf这个是syslog服务的主要配置文件,根据定义的规则导向日志信息。日志存放在: /var/log 内核启动信息:/var/log/dmesg    查看:dmesg | less 默认系统错误信息文件: /var
对于Linux系统安全来说,日志文件是极其重要的工具。logrotate程序是一个日志文件管理工具。用于分割日志文件,删除旧的日志文件,并创建新的日志文件,起到“转储”作用。可以节省磁盘空间。下面就对logrotate日志轮转操作做一梳理记录:1)配置文件介绍Linux系统默认安装logrotate工具,它默认的配置文件在:/etc/logrotate.conf /etc/logrotate.d/
       不管是任何操作系统,编程语言,中间服务件还是网络设备在出现各种问题的时候大多数都会依赖日志来判断问题的根源,而且重要的服务器上还会建立日志备份服务器,例如信息安全等级保护来说,所有的安全设备以及服务器的日志必须保存半年以上,由此可见日志有多重要了吧!1.日志服务启动ps aux | grep rsyslogd #查看服务启动 chkconf
一、最常用查看日志方法:实时日志: tail -f XXX.log 搜索关键字附近日志: cat -n filename | grep "关键字"二、查看日志常用命令tail:-n 是显示行号;相当于nl命令;例子如下: tail -100f test.log 实时监控100行日志 tail -n 10 test.log 查询日志尾部最后10行的日志; tail -n +10
转载 2023-08-21 18:25:12
993阅读
前言 唉,这周本来想彻底研究一下树的数据结构,结果搭建了基于nginx+php-fpm的web server运行模式,回到宿舍就太累没心思再思考数据结构和算法,就这样吧,这周就只搞运维了,虽然之间也写了点php代码学了点设计模式 syslogd:记录日志文件的服务日志内容的一般格式 一般来说,系统产生的信息经过syslog而记录下来的数据中,每条信息均会记录下面几个重要数据
  • 1
  • 2
  • 3
  • 4
  • 5